RST (Pin 3/Pin 2): Reset Logic Output. Pulls low when any voltage input is below the reset threshold and is held low for 200ms after all voltage inputs are above threshold. This pin has a weak pull-up to VCC and may be pulled above VCC using an external pull-up. GND (Pin 4/Pin 1): Device Ground. (TS8 Package/DDB8 Package) LTC2908-A1/LTC2908-B1 VADJ2(Pin5/Pin8):AdjustableVoltageInput2.SeeTable 1 for recommended ADJ resistors values. V3 (Pin 6/Pin 7): Voltage Input 3. VADJ1 (Pin7/Pin6): Adjustable Voltage Input 1. See Table 1 for recommended ADJ resistors values. V1 (Pin 8/Pin 5): Voltage Input 1. The greater of V1, V2 is also the internal VCC. The operating voltage on this pin shall not exceed 6V. When in normal operation (V1 > V2), this pin draws approximately 26 μA. When this pin is not acting as the VCC(V2>V1),thispindrawsapproximately8μA.Bypass this pin to ground with a 0.1μF (or greater) capacitor. Exposed Pad (Pin 9, DDB8 Only): Exposed Pad may be left open or connected to device ground. |
